Researchers from Rice University have cooked up a rather interesting and promising battery technology capable of turning any surface into a lithium-ion battery. The technology consists of five spray-painted layers that make up all the components of a traditional battery, including two current collectors, a cathode, an anode, and a polymer separator in the middle. All that remains is a power source, and as the researchers demonstrated, spray-paintable batteries can be combined with solar cells.
A team of engineers from Rice University in Houston, Texas, constructed what amounts to a full blown battery where all the essential components are integrated into a single nanowire, Physorg.com reports. The research team says their accomplishment could help give researchers a better understanding of electrochemistry at the nanoscale level, and with a bit of tweaking, it could one day be used to power nanoelectronic devices.
